description In this study, the waste glass (WG) is considered as a fine aggregate in the concretemixture. WG is used after grinding to size according to Iraqi sand specificationsNo.45. The waste glass has been used instead of sand in different proportions whichare 0%, 33%, 66% and 100%. The effects of WG on compressive strength of theconcrete and unit weight are analysed. As results of this study, WG is determined tohave a significant effect upon the reduction of its compressive strength and there is asignificant decreasing of its unit weight. As for cost analysis, it was determined tolower the cost of concrete production. This study was an environmental one inconsideration of the fact that WG could be used in the concrete as fine aggreagateswithout the need for a high cost or rigorous energy.
